Is the use of Podox CV Duo Dry Syrup safe for pregnant women?
Pregnant women may get mild side effects from Podox Cv.
Is the use of Podox CV Duo Dry Syrup safe during breastfeeding?
If you are breastfeeding, you may experience some harmful effects of Podox Cv. In case you experience any of these, discontinue its use until you consult your doctor.
What is the effect of Podox CV Duo Dry Syrup on the Kidneys?
There may be some adverse effects on kidney after taking Podox Cv. If you observe any such side effects, stop taking this drug. Consume this medicine again only if your doctor advises you to do so.
What is the effect of Podox CV Duo Dry Syrup on the Liver?
There may be an adverse effect on the liver after taking Podox Cv. If you observe any side effects on your body then stop taking this drug. Take this medicine again only if your doctor advises you to do so.
What is the effect of Podox CV Duo Dry Syrup on the Heart?
Side effects of Podox Cv rarely affect the heart.
